Firearms trade fair stands

General view of the Yazıcılarav stand at the fair 2025 in Istanbul: a 60 sqm maxima system build.

At a firearms fair the product ends up in the visitor’s hands: a shotgun is shouldered, a grip is tested, a scope is pointed down the hall. We build the stand around that contact. Lockable display cases lit from inside, a rack wall that holds a long gun without the barrel drooping, a counter at bench height where the action can be worked. The organiser’s display rules go into our technical file at the start, so nobody is rebuilding a cabinet on build-up day.

What we do for you at firearms fairs

We draw the stand, produce it in our own workshop in Beylikdüzü, build it in the hall with our own crew and take it down when the fair closes. Graphics and print, the technical file for the hall management, and for fairs abroad the freight, the ATA Carnet and customs for the stand are ours as well. The firearms themselves travel on your own permits and export papers; we move the cases, the rack wall and the furniture.

Two things get extra time in this sector: security and light. Lock type, glass thickness and the night cover are drawn to the organiser’s display rules. Lighting comes in at an angle that shows the grain of the wood and the finish of the metal; a polished barrel under the wrong lamp turns into a white smear. For optics we keep a long sight line.

Which stand type for a firearms stand

  • Maxima system: 12–200 square metres, built in 1–3 days. Both 2025 stands were maxima builds; the cases and the rack wall are fixed to the aluminium grid.
  • Custom timber build: 20–500 square metres, built in 2–5 days. For brands that want recessed cabinets, an uninterrupted surface that sits well next to walnut stocks, and a closed meeting room.

On a plot with two open sides the rifle wall faces the aisle.

Frequently asked

How do you mount the firearms, and are the cases lockable?
Long guns sit on two-point racks that hold barrel and stock; handguns go into lockable glass cases. Lock, glass and the night cover follow the organiser’s display rules, and we track the Prohunt and IWA rules in the technical file.
Who ships the stand to Nuremberg and who clears customs?
We do. The stand leaves the workshop by road, we open the ATA Carnet and we handle the border crossing; that is how every stand of ours travels to Nuremberg. Your samples go separately on their own permits.
How many days does the build take, and is it your own crew?
Our own crew builds and dismantles. A 60 square metre maxima stand is standing in the hall within 1–3 days; for a custom timber build we plan 2–5 days. We walk the stand together the day before opening and hand over the cabinet keys.
